Clipperton

Cliperton Island, als known as Clipperton Atoll and previously as Clipperton's Rock, is an uninhabited French coral atoll in the eastern Pacific Ocean about 1,280 km (690 miles) from Acapulco, Mexico. It has a total area of 8.9 sq km (3.4 sq mi). The island has remained uninhabited except for a period between 1905 to 1917 when Mexico established a small military colony and 1944 to 1945 when the United States established a weather station there. Since then, there have been a few scientific expeditions to the island.
